B.Tech Marine Engineering Sponsorship is an essential step for students who want to build a successful career in the Engine Department of the Merchant Navy. It ensures that a candidate is selected by a shipping company before starting the 4-year B.Tech Marine Engineering course.
With sponsorship, candidates receive a confirmed pathway to onboard training and future employment after completing their degree. It provides security, confidence, and a clear career direction from the very beginning.
Sponsorship is a formal selection process conducted by shipping companies where candidates are chosen before starting their marine engineering degree. The company issues a sponsorship letter confirming onboard training after course completion.
This ensures that candidates can join ships as Trainee Marine Engineers after completing their education, which is necessary to progress towards higher ranks.
Without sponsorship, candidates may face difficulty in getting onboard placement after completing their degree, which can delay their career significantly.
